Dechene drywall in context

About Dechene

Annexed to the City in 1972 as part of West Jasper Place, most of Dechene's appealing keyhole crescents and curving, quiet streets date from the 1980s.

Level 4 vs Level 5 drywall finish in Edmonton

When Level 4 is the right call

Level 4 is the standard residential finish and the right choice for most Edmonton homes — bedrooms, hallways and living spaces painted in standard sheens. It is a clean, smooth, paint-ready surface at the best value.

When Level 5 is worth it

Level 5 is a full skim coat over the Level 4, worth it where imperfections would otherwise show: large windows and raking light, glossy or dark paint, feature walls and flat ceilings. For a full breakdown, see our Level 4 vs Level 5 drywall finish guide.
